- Lu Bu: The strongest warrior of the Three Kingdoms era. Lu Bu is all about raw power and brutal strength. His fighting style is direct and overwhelming, always seeking to crush his opponents with sheer force. Seeing him in action is a testament to the might of the human spirit. Lu Bu is the first human champion. His character embodies strength and a fearless attitude. He goes into battle without hesitation, and viewers are instantly hooked by his unwavering confidence. His battles are visually stunning, with the animators bringing his raw power to life with every swing of his weapon.
- Adam: The father of humanity, Adam is portrayed as a man of incredible resilience and determination. He has the unique ability to copy any technique he sees, making him a formidable opponent. His love for his children (humanity) fuels his fighting spirit, making him one of the most beloved characters. Adam's battles are a celebration of the human will to protect and defend. The emotion and intensity he brings to each fight make him a standout character, symbolizing the best of humanity.

What is Record of Ragnarok? The Basic Rundown
Record of Ragnarok (also known as Shūmatsu no Valkyrie) is a Japanese manga series that was later adapted into an anime. The premise is simple: the gods of various pantheons decide to destroy humanity. However, the Valkyries, a group of warrior women, propose a last-ditch effort – a tournament called Ragnarok. In this tournament, thirteen of humanity's greatest champions must battle thirteen of the most powerful gods in one-on-one combat. If humanity wins seven battles, they are spared. If the gods win seven, well, it's curtains for the human race. The stakes are as high as they get, guys!
